The Significance of Return to Player (RTP) Percentages in Online Slots
At the heart of player trust is the concept of Return to Player (RTP), a statistical indicator representing the percentage of wagered money that a slot game is designed to pay back over its lifetime. For example, a game with an RTP of 96% return to player signals that, on average, players can expect to recover 96% of their total bets. While individual sessions can vary, high RTP percentages mitigate the risk of deceptive payout practices by establishing expected fairness rooted in mathematical probability.

Technological Innovations Supporting Transparency
Modern online slots are leveraging blockchain technology and cryptographic proofs to validate fairness, allowing players to independently verify game outcomes. Such innovations coalesce around the core principle of transparency, transforming RTP disclosures from mere marketing figures into verified, trustable metrics.
